Re: Cpanel Login issues Then Linksys Router issues

Some routers have the modem built in. Some don't. Can apply to both ADSL or Fibre lines.

 

As you've already found out, It really does pay to do the research before committing to buy. I used the Draytek Vigor 130 Modem but it can be pricey - you get what you pay for though.
